What Is Business?

At its core, business is any organization or enterprising entity engaged in commercial, industrial, or professional activities. Businesses can be categorized into various types, including:

  • Sole proprietorships — owned by one individual.

  • Partnerships — owned by two or more individuals.

  • Corporations — separate legal entities owned by shareholders.

  • Non-profits — focused on social goals rather than profits.

Each type has its unique structure, benefits, and challenges.

The Purpose of Business

The primary goal of most businesses is to generate profit by delivering value to customers. However, business also plays a broader role in society by:

  • Creating Employment: Businesses provide jobs and livelihoods for millions.

  • Driving Innovation: Through research and development, businesses bring new products and services to market.

  • Supporting Communities: Many businesses engage in corporate social responsibility, supporting local causes and sustainable practices.

  • Contributing to Economic Growth: Successful businesses pay taxes and stimulate economic activities, helping economies grow.

Key Elements of a Successful Business

Running a successful business requires several critical components, including:

  • Clear Vision and Strategy: Understanding the market and setting goals.

  • Effective Management: Organizing resources and leading teams efficiently.

  • Quality Products or Services: Meeting or exceeding customer expectations.

  • Marketing and Sales: Reaching customers and convincing them to buy.

  • Financial Planning: Managing revenues, costs, and investments wisely.

Challenges in Business

Despite its rewards, business also involves risks and challenges such as competition, changing market trends, regulatory compliance, and economic fluctuations. Successful entrepreneurs and companies adapt to these challenges by staying flexible, innovative, and customer-focused.
